Optimus and Full Self-Driving
The integration of FSD technology into Optimus presents a unique opportunity to expand the functionality of the humanoid robot. Leveraging Tesla’s robust FSD dataset, Optimus can potentially perform driverless operations not only in Tesla vehicles but across any car model. This development could make Optimus an indispensable asset, capable of performing a myriad of tasks from day-to-day errands to serving as a high-tech assistant.
Optimus: A Transformational Asset
Tesla Optimus is poised to become a cornerstone of the company’s product lineup, potentially accounting for a staggering 80% of Tesla’s future value. As a multifunctional humanoid robot, Optimus is designed to eliminate trivial and monotonous tasks from human life, thereby boosting productivity and efficiency. The possibilities are endless, ranging from household chores to complex industrial applications.
